Why use digital marketing?

Digital marketing is a term that is used to describe the process of marketing using digital channels. This includes the use of digital tools such as search engine optimization, social media, and email marketing.

There are many reasons to use digital marketing. Perhaps the most obvious reason is that it allows businesses to reach a large audience with relatively little effort. It is also relatively inexpensive to design and implement a digital marketing campaign, and it can be done quickly and easily. Additionally, digital marketing is very effective in terms of tracking results and measuring success. Finally, digital marketing can be easily customized to target specific demographics, which allows businesses to focus their efforts on reaching their desired customers.

Digital marketing is the process of using online channels to generate leads, capture leads, and nurture leads. Lead generation is the process of attracting potential customers to your website or landing page. Lead capturing is the process of capturing leads through forms or other means. Lead nurturing is the process of developing relationships with leads, typically through email or other automated means.

In contrast to other marketing models, the 7 Cs Compass Model considers both the marketing strategies as well as the segment to which the strategies are being targeted. The seven Cs are Corporation, Commodity, Cost, Communication, Channel, Consumer and Circumstances.

This model is helpful in ensuring that all aspects of the marketing mix are considered and aligned with the target market. It is also useful in that it can be adapted to different marketing situations. For example, if a company is targeting a new market segment, the 7 Cs can be used to ensure that all aspects of the marketing mix are considered and integrated into the overall strategy.

The four Ps are product, price, place, and promotion. They are an example of a “marketing mix,” or the combined tools and methodologies used by marketers to achieve their marketing objectives. Product refers to the physical product or service being offered, price is the value placed on that product or service, place is the location where the product or service will be made available, and promotion is the marketing campaign used to generate interest in the product or service.

A digital marketing benchmark is a goal or measure against which the success of a digital marketing campaign can be compared. The 5 characteristics of a successful digital marketing benchmark are:

1. Target audience engagement level: The level of engagement of the target audience with the digital marketing campaign should be monitored in order to gauge the success of the campaign.

2. Target audience size: The size of the target audience should be considered when setting a digital marketing benchmark. A larger target audience may require a higher level of engagement to be considered successful.

3. Digital marketing campaign goal: The goal of the digital marketing campaign should be taken into account when setting a benchmark. A campaign that is designed to generate leads may have a different benchmark than a campaign that is designed to increase brand awareness.

4. Digital content stream: The digital content stream associated with the campaign should be considered when setting a benchmark. The level of engagement with the content will influence the success of the campaign.

5. Seasonality: The seasonality of the target audience should be considered when setting a digital marketing benchmark. The level of engagement may be different during different times of the year.

What are the 5 stages of digital marketing?

1. Plan: The first stage in any digital marketing strategy is to set your marketing goals and objectives, and plan how you will achieve them. This includes understanding your audience, your competition, your budgets and your resources.

2. Reach: The second stage is all about reaching your target audience through the right channels. This means understanding which channels will work best for you, and using them to reach as many people as possible.

3. Act: Once you have reached your target audience, it’s time to start engaging with them. This means creating compelling content that will encourage them to take action, such as subscribing to your newsletter, downloading a white paper or making a purchase.

4. Convert: The fourth stage is all about converting your leads into customers. This means making it easy for them to buy from you, and providing them with the support they need to use your product or service.

5. Engage: The final stage is all about keeping your customers engaged with your brand. This means creating loyalty programmes, engaging with them on social media, and providing them with great customer service.
